<p>Today&#39;s thirteen-year-olds read at about the same level teens did back in 1971. If you&#39;re raising a struggling reader that explains a lot. By the end of this episode, you&#39;ll reframe your child&#39;s struggling reading as Swiss cheese, holes you can find and fill.</p><p><br></p><p>Kids who slip past the early school years get very good at hiding. They memorize, they guess, they lean on others. That isn&#39;t laziness. It&#39;s a gap in the system, and gaps can be filled.</p><p><br></p><p>I&#39;m Tracy Young, an Orton-Gillingham trained, ALTA-certified tutor and the mom of a dyslexic daughter.
